Serra do Marumbi is a mountain in Paraná, South and has an elevation of 1,414 metres. Serra do Marumbi is situated nearby to the locality Sítio Agenor R. de Barros, as well as near Monumento Natural Estadual e Área Especial de Interesse Turístico Marumbi.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 1,414 metres
- Categories: mountain range and landform
- Location: Paraná, South, Brazil, South America
